Fixed Payment Model
Emirates Electrical Engineering delivers a Fixed Payment Model that provides a structured and predictable pathway to energy efficiency. Under this model, Emirates Electrical Engineering funds, delivers, and maintains the retrofit solution, while the client pays a fixed monthly service fee over the agreed term. This enables organizations to implement efficiency upgrades without upfront capital investment, while retaining the benefit of improved asset performance, reduced energy consumption, and greater budget certainty.
